  • Obsessive Compulsive Disorder (OCD)
    • OCD is a condition characterised by obsessions and compulsions
    • Behavioural Characteristic of OCD
      • Compulsions
        • Compulsions are repetitive
          • Sufferers of OCD feel compelled to repeat certain behaviours, for example hand washing
        • Compulsions reduce anxiety
          • Compulsions are performed to manage the anxiety produced by the obsession, for example washing hands is a response of a fear of germs
    • Emotional Characteristic of OCD
      • Anxiety & Distress
        • Obsessive thoughts are unpleasant, and anxiety that goes with these can be overwhelming
      • Guilt
    • Cognitive Characteristic of OCD
      • Obsessive Thoughts
        • Thoughts that reoccur over and over, these vary and can be unpleasant
      • Cognitive Strategies to deal with the obsession
        • A religious person tormented by guilt may respond by praying
      • Insight to Excessive Anxiety
        • People are aware that their thought are irrational but insight of this OCD sufferers experience thoughts about worse case scenarios that might result if their anxieties were justified
